Flat 504, Adeleide Wharf, 120 Queensbridge Road, London, E2 8FB is a leasehold flat built between 1996-2002. The property offers approximately 764 square feet of living space and is situated on the 5th flo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£819,729 , which equates to approximately £1,073 per square foot. It was last sold on 6 Dec 2007 for £452,000. Since then, the value has increased by £367,729, representing a 81.4% increase, or approximately 4.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£819,729 is:

  • 28.9% higher than the average property price on Queensbridge Road
  • 45.7% higher than the average in the E2 8FB postcode area
  • and 6.3% lower than the average price for London as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 19 November 2018,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

Flat 504, Adeleide Wharf, 120 Queensbridge Road, London, Hackney, Greater London Authority, E2 8FB has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 19 Nov 2018.

This property is heated by a shared community system (community scheme). Community heating means the heat is supplied from a central source serving multiple homes. A community heating scheme is used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 29 Sep 2008, when the property was rated B. The current rating of C re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 9.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system changed from from main system to community scheme,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from average thermal transmittance = 0.20 w/m?k to flat, insulated (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to average.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from average thermal transmittance = 0.23 w/m?k to system built, as built, insulated (assumed), changing energy efficiency from very good to good.
  • The windows were upgraded from high performance gl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 66%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 83%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
